Ho Chi Minh,Vietnam Feb 25,2015 Saigon Central Post Office is located at Ho Chi Minh, Vietnam [1] It was designed by Alfred Foulhoux, [2] but is often erroneously credited as being the work of Gustave Eiffel or a collaboration. The Saigon Central Post Office is one of the most beautiful preserved remains of the French from their colonial period in Ho Chi Minh City.
